Возможно ли превью картинок (в списке тем)?

Список разделов phpBBex 1.x (поддерживается) Поддержка 1.x

Описание: У вас проблемы с phpBBex 1.x и вам необходима помощь? Спрашивайте здесь!
Правила раздела: Одна тема — один вопрос или группа связанных вопросов. Обязательно формируйте внятный заголовок, максимально отражающий суть вопроса. Подробно описывайте проблему. Не забудьте указать версию phpBBex и какие моды установлены, по возможности добавьте скриншоты проблемы или ссылку на страницу с проблемой.
Модератор: Поддержка

Сообщение #1 dream.reckless » 16.04.2013, 10:26

Скажите, возможно ли как то сделать сделать так, чтобы была одна (может первая) картинка из первого сообщения в теме. То есть превью. Как бы это сделать? Скачал мод, установил, но конечно он не работает.

Вот сам мод, может кому то пригодится.

Уже два раза думал о том, что может перейти на обычный phpbb. Просто у меня нет времени, чтобы только тем и заниматься что обучаться по коду.

Просто столько неудобств в плане модулей, причиной всего лишь не более чем "В целом код написан в духе phpBB 3, ничего нового изобретено не было." (VEG)
Вложения
First_Topic_[pic]_on_Forum_Index_v.0.0.6.rar
(45.75 КБ) Скачиваний: 478
dream.reckless
Автор темы
Аватара
Репутация: 5
С нами: 11 лет 4 месяца

Сообщение #2 VEG » 16.04.2013, 11:51

dream.reckless:В целом код написан в духе phpBB 3, ничего нового изобретено не было.
С момента первого анонса, откуда вы это процитировали, phpBBex сильно изменился. В ядре уже произведены некоторые улучшения, и это только начало.

dream.reckless:Уже два раза думал о том, что может перейти на обычный phpbb.
Вы всегда можете это сделать. Базы полностью совместимы. Используя оригинальный STK вы можете удалить все данные phpBBex, оставив только данные phpBB. Единственное, что вам нужно будет сделать вручную — добавить префикс к именам файлов аватар. Для этого просто загрузите свою аватарку, посмотрите, какой мусор будет в начале имени файла перед id пользователя (например, в 0123456789abcdef0123456789abcdef_2.gif, 2.gif — это реальное имя файла, а остальное — мусор), и скопируйте этот мусор в имена файлов других аватар.

Добавлено спустя 3 минуты 35 секунд:
dream.reckless:Скачал мод, установил, но конечно он не работает.
Раз не работает, значит где-то есть какой-то конфликт. Обычно это явно видно при установке. Если при установке возникли проблемы с конкретным кодом (например, не нашли код, который нужно искать) — об этом следует написать. Возможно, это поможет решению проблемы.
VEG M
Администратор
Аватара
Откуда: Finland
Репутация: 1653
С нами: 11 лет 11 месяцев

Сообщение #3 dream.reckless » 16.04.2013, 11:58

VEG:Раз не работает, значит где-то есть какой-то конфликт. Обычно это явно видно при установке. Если при установке возникли проблемы с конкретным кодом (например, не нашли код, который нужно искать) — об этом следует написать. Возможно, это поможет решению проблемы.

Вот сейчас пробую разобраться в чем же дело может быть...

Добавлено спустя 46 минут 13 секунд:
VEG:Раз не работает, значит где-то есть какой-то конфликт. Обычно это явно видно при установке. Если при установке возникли проблемы с конкретным кодом (например, не нашли код, который нужно искать) — об этом следует написать. Возможно, это поможет решению проблемы.

Не подскажите, на что указывает ошибка?

Код: Выделить всё
Общая ошибка
SQL ERROR [ mysql4 ]

Unknown column 'topic_desc' in 'field list' [1054]

SQL

INSERT INTO phpbbtopics (topic_poster, topic_time, topic_last_view_time, forum_id, icon_id, topic_approved, topic_title, topic_first_poster_name, topic_first_poster_colour, topic_type, topic_time_limit, topic_priority, topic_attachment, topic_desc) VALUES (2, 1366104686, 1366104686, 1, 0, 1, 'Проба', 'admin', 'AA0000', 0, 0, 0, 0, '')

BACKTRACE

FILE: (not given by php)
LINE: (not given by php)
CALL: msg_handler()

FILE: [ROOT]/includes/db/dbal.php
LINE: 757
CALL: trigger_error()

FILE: [ROOT]/includes/db/mysql.php
LINE: 175
CALL: dbal->sql_error()

FILE: [ROOT]/includes/functions_posting.php
LINE: 2053
CALL: dbal_mysql->sql_query()

FILE: [ROOT]/posting.php
LINE: 1152
CALL: submit_post()

Ошибка при создании темы, после "манипуляций" с файлами.

Добавлено спустя 4 минуты 35 секунд:
Unknown column 'topic_desc' in 'field list' [1054]

Я так понял, что нет колонки 'topic_desc' в чем? в таблице 'field list'?
dream.reckless
Автор темы
Аватара
Репутация: 5
С нами: 11 лет 4 месяца

Сообщение #4 VEG » 16.04.2013, 13:08

Ну вот, вы ругали phpBBex, а у вас возникла проблема из-за кода, который к phpBBex отношения не имеет. В коде phpBBex никогда не было поля topic_desc, в устанавливаемом вами моде тоже нет этого поля. Судя по всему это кусок от не до конца установленного мода Topic Descriptions.

Добавлено спустя 2 минуты 3 секунды:
dream.reckless:Я так понял, что нет колонки 'topic_desc' в чем? в таблице 'field list'?
Там же ниже указан запрос. В таблице phpbbtopics.
VEG M
Администратор
Аватара
Откуда: Finland
Репутация: 1653
С нами: 11 лет 11 месяцев

Сообщение #5 dream.reckless » 16.04.2013, 13:10

VEG:Ну вот, вы ругали phpBBex, а у вас возникла проблема из-за кода, который к phpBBex отношения не имеет. В коде phpBBex никогда не было поля topic_desc, в устанавливаемом вами моде тоже нет этого поля. Судя по всему это кусок от не до конца установленного мода Topic Descriptions.

Если бы, но я не устанавливал никакие моды совсем. Тем более тот, что Вы привели.
Что же делать тогда? Попробую добавить как то запросом.. (это я делаю на тест-форуме)
dream.reckless
Автор темы
Аватара
Репутация: 5
С нами: 11 лет 4 месяца

Сообщение #6 VEG » 16.04.2013, 13:12

dream.reckless, могу повторить ещё раз. Поиск по файлам phpBBex и по файлам устанавливаемого вами мода показал, что там нет topic_desc. А это значит, что в запрос
Код: Выделить всё
INSERT INTO phpbbtopics (topic_poster, topic_time, topic_last_view_time, forum_id, icon_id, topic_approved, topic_title, topic_first_poster_name, topic_first_poster_colour, topic_type, topic_time_limit, topic_priority, topic_attachment, topic_desc) VALUES (2, 1366104686, 1366104686, 1, 0, 1, 'Проба', 'admin', 'AA0000', 0, 0, 0, 0, '')
вы добавили это поле самостоятельно, скорее всего устанавливая какой-то другой мод.
VEG M
Администратор
Аватара
Откуда: Finland
Репутация: 1653
С нами: 11 лет 11 месяцев

Сообщение #7 dream.reckless » 16.04.2013, 13:15

VEG:добавили это поле самостоятельно

ой, да, добавил самостоятельно при правке alt-тов, просто не думал что это так может повлиять. Хорошо, теперь что делать.. нужно его как то добавить? В таблицу? В topic_desc содержимое tipic_title.Topic_desc передается атрибуту alt.

Добавлено спустя 2 часа 27 минут:
К сожалению решение мне не подошло, хотя проблему решил с помощью удаления 'topic_desc' :smile:
dream.reckless
Автор темы
Аватара
Репутация: 5
С нами: 11 лет 4 месяца

Сообщение #8 VEG » 16.04.2013, 19:28

dream.reckless:К сожалению решение мне не подошло
То есть на phpBB 3 оно бы вам тоже не подошло. Возможно, вам следует воспользоваться галереей, а не форумом.
VEG M
Администратор
Аватара
Откуда: Finland
Репутация: 1653
С нами: 11 лет 11 месяцев

Сообщение #9 dream.reckless » 16.04.2013, 19:40

VEG:То есть на phpBB 3 оно бы вам тоже не подошло. Возможно, вам следует воспользоваться галереей, а не форумом.


Спасибо больше за предложение, но все же надо вывод фото из первого сообщения, но лучше всего это конечно описание темы с применением bb-тегов.
dream.reckless
Автор темы
Аватара
Репутация: 5
С нами: 11 лет 4 месяца

Сообщение #10 rvszap » 09.02.2014, 17:30

dream.reckless,
Мне тоже интересен поднятый Вами вопрос. У Вас получилось поставить мод, показывает первую картинку в названии темы в списке тем?
Имею в виду вот это
Новый рисунок (2).jpg

Новый рисунок.jpg
rvszap
Репутация: 6
С нами: 11 лет 1 месяц

Сообщение #11 assa » 10.02.2014, 00:43

rvszap, данный мод легко становится на phpBBex автомодом. Только в viewforum_body.html немного не туда вставляется картинка, нужно поправить.
Вложения
phpbbex_'First_Topic.png
phpbbex_'First_Topic.png (48.83 КБ) Просмотров: 6857
assa
Репутация: 6
С нами: 11 лет 11 месяцев

Сообщение #12 rvszap » 10.02.2014, 22:33

assa, спасибо.
Попробую поставить вручную.
rvszap
Репутация: 6
С нами: 11 лет 1 месяц


Вернуться в Поддержка 1.x



cron